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Sara Martinez conducted an unannounced annual required visit. LPA was granted entry and met with caregiver Victoria Blount, who was informed of the purpose of the visit. Administrator Deborah Lee arrived during LPA's visit. At the time of the visit there was one (1) staff and zero (0) clients present. The clients served are adults between the ages of 18-59 specialized for the needs of consumers with severe hearing impairment. LPA conducted a tour of the interior and exterior, reviewed facility documents and conducted interviews. LPA observed the following:

LPA observed the client bedrooms and staff room. Physical plant, floors, windows, and doors were observed to be clean and fixtures and furniture were in good repair and were present. Facility contained a backyard patio with a shaded sitting area. Facility does not have any bodies of water on the property or guns and ammunition. The sharp and dangerous objects were observed to be locked and inaccessible to clients. The smoke detector and carbon monoxide was operational and the facility contained a charged fire extinguisher located in the kitchen. Hot water temperature was recorded at 119 degree F. Facility contained PPE equipment and cleaning supplies to do regular cleaning of the facility. LPA reviewed the facility's infection control plan which met department requirements.



LPA observed facility kitchen had the ability and appliances to prepare food and possessed equipment in good working condition. LPA observed the facility met the required 2-day supply of perishable and 7-day supply of non-perishable foods.

LPA reviewed two (2) staff files and training. All staff have criminal record clearance, health screening, and updated training along with CPR/First Aid Certification. Two (2) client files were reviewed, and possessed all required paperwork including Admissions Agreement, Individual Program Plan (IPP), and updated Physician's Report. LPA inspected the P&I for two (2) clients and found no discrepancies.

All client medication was centrally stored and locked in a cabinet located in the kitchen. LPA reviewed client medications for two (2) clients and found all medication listed on MARS and all required labeling was found to be in place.

LPA reviewed the facility's emergency and disaster plan. LPA reviewed documentation showing the facility's last fire and earthquake drills was conducted on 02/25/2024, which met the department requirements. LPA observed emergency supplies and first aid kit with all required items.

No deficiencies were cited at the time of the visit.
